Joy Behar EMBARRASSES Herself on The View My Daily Liberty 7 months ago IMAGE ABOVE FROM VIDEO BELOW TOP COMMENTS FROM VIDEO BELOW Cant wait til no more clips of that communist show….cancel that propaganda You can‚Äôt be embarrassed if you have no shame to begin with.